Meet Renea Williams, she isn't your average teenager, unlike most girls that love to party and flirt with boys, she prefers to stay at home and read. She's basically invisible to the whole school, people don't know her but they know of her. She gets straight A's, doesn't socialize at all, she's definitely not popular and hates people generally; but not kids which is one reason why she babysits. Now meet Blaide Allen, he is your average "bad boy." He party's hard and is barley passing school. He's a big smirking mystery and no one seems to know much about him.
